What Does It Mean When a Milestone Inspection Identifies Structural Deterioration?
Florida Statute 553.899 defines a milestone inspection as a structural inspection of a building's load-bearing elements and primary structural members and systems by a Florida-licensed architect or engineer. Its purpose concerns life safety and the building's general structural condition. It is not an inspection for compliance with the Florida Building Code or the fire safety code.
The statewide requirement generally applies to covered residential condominium and cooperative buildings that are three or more habitable stories. The initial milestone is generally due by December 31 of the year the building reaches 30 years of age, measured from the certificate of occupancy, and every 10 years thereafter. A local enforcement agency may determine that local circumstances require the initial inspection at 25 years; that decision is based on local circumstances rather than an automatic coastal-distance rule.
Owners sometimes say a building “failed” its milestone inspection. That phrase can obscure what the report actually does. The statutory framework speaks in terms of findings: substantial structural deterioration, recommended repairs, unsafe or dangerous conditions if observed, damaged items that merit remedial or preventive repair, and areas requiring further inspection. Those findings must be read in their specific context; they do not mean every listed condition has the same urgency or structural significance.
Phase 1 vs. Phase 2 — What Changes?
Phase 1 is a visual examination and qualitative structural assessment performed by the licensed architect or engineer. If the professional finds no signs of substantial structural deterioration, Phase 2 is not required. The report may still identify maintenance, remedial or preventive repairs, but the statutory path does not automatically advance to Phase 2.
If Phase 1 identifies substantial structural deterioration, Phase 2 is required. At the inspector's direction, Phase 2 may include destructive or nondestructive testing. Its purpose is to evaluate the structural distress sufficiently to confirm whether substantial structural deterioration is present and to recommend a program for assessing and repairing the damaged portions. The architect or engineer controls that investigation and the resulting professional conclusions.
Read the Engineering Report Before Calling Contractors
Before requesting prices, the association and its design professional should identify exactly what has been issued. Does the report locate conditions by elevation, level and element? Does it distinguish immediate protection from permanent repair? Are signed and sealed repair drawings, specifications and repair types included, or must those documents still be developed? Are testing, access, shoring, permits or review hold points defined? A report that establishes findings may not yet be a bid-ready construction package.
Calling several contractors with an incomplete scope invites incomparable assumptions. One bidder may include access, coatings and waterproofing reinstatement while another prices only visible concrete. One may carry estimated quantities and another a lump sum. Clarifying the engineering basis first produces a more useful competition and reduces avoidable disputes after award.
From Engineering Findings to a Bid-Ready Repair Scope
A bid-ready package translates findings into executable requirements. It typically identifies repair types and details, anticipated locations and quantities, measurement units, material and preparation requirements, testing or observation points, temporary protection, finishes and interfaces with waterproofing or building-envelope systems. It should also state how concealed conditions and quantity changes will be documented and approved.
- Use a consistent location system by building, elevation, level, unit, balcony or garage bay.
- Define measurable repair categories and units rather than relying on a broad allowance.
- Identify access, protection, permits and engineer-required temporary works.
- Separate base scope, alternates and allowances so proposals can be compared fairly.
- Establish submittals, RFIs, EOR review points, testing and closeout requirements before award.
Selecting a Structural Restoration Contractor
Condominium structural repair in Florida is not simply a concrete-placement exercise. A qualified concrete restoration contractor must plan access and containment, protect occupied areas, perform controlled removal, coordinate inspections and RFIs, measure evolving quantities, manage coating and waterproofing interfaces, and maintain records that the association and EOR can follow. Experience with occupied high-rise or large residential work is particularly relevant because production, resident communication and safety controls are inseparable.

What Happens When the Building Is Opened Up?
Milestone and Phase 2 observations provide critical information, but some repair boundaries remain concealed until finishes and unsound concrete are removed. An opening may reveal a larger delaminated area, reinforcement condition that differs from the assumed detail, an embedded item or an interface requiring revised treatment. Quantity growth can therefore be legitimate, but it should never become a license for uncontrolled change orders.
Good change control ties every variance to a location ID, before-and-after photographs, dimensions, the applicable unit price and written EOR direction when the repair type or engineering requirement changes. The contractor reports what is exposed and measures the work. The Engineer of Record evaluates the condition and directs design-related changes. The association receives a traceable basis for review rather than a total that appears only in a pay application.

Typical Field Sequence
01
Mobilize, protect and establish access
Set up approved access, pedestrian and property protection, debris containment, staging and any specified shoring or temporary works.
02
Map and identify repairs
Connect each work area to the drawings, repair type and location ID so quantities, photographs and decisions remain traceable.
03
Perform controlled demolition
Saw-cut or define perimeters as required and remove deteriorated concrete by methods suited to the element and project documents.
04
Evaluate and prepare reinforcement
Expose, clean and prepare steel as specified; report section loss, unexpected geometry or differing conditions for professional review.
05
Obtain EOR direction
Pause at required hold points. The EOR reviews conditions and provides direction for supplementary reinforcement, changed details or other engineering matters.
06
Form and reconstruct
Install specified reinforcement and formwork, place the approved repair material, consolidate and finish it in accordance with project requirements.
07
Cure and restore protective systems
Protect the repair during the specified cure period, then reinstate coatings, waterproofing, sealants and adjacent finishes where required.
08
Complete QA/QC and closeout
Compile quantities, photographs, submittals, testing, RFIs, EOR directions and completion records for review and reinspection.


Occupied Condominium Logistics and Safety
Structural restoration takes place beside homes, balconies, windows, pedestrian routes, vehicles and active building systems. The plan must address balcony and unit access, work hours, noise, dust, falling-object protection, parking changes, weather, material movement, resident notices and emergency contacts. Work is commonly phased by elevation, stack or garage zone so the building can remain functional without opening more areas than the team can safely manage and close.
Temporary protection and shoring are project-specific. They should follow the design professional's documents and the contractor's safety planning, not assumptions drawn from another building. Communication is equally important: residents should understand when access is required, what will be closed, what conditions may change the schedule and whom to contact.
The 365-Day Repair-Commencement Rule
For substantial structural deterioration identified in a Phase 2 report, the applicable repair process must move forward within the timeframe established by the local enforcement agency, and repairs must be commenced within the statutory 365-day period. Local requirements may impose an earlier schedule. The rule concerns commencement; it does not state that every repair project must be completed within 365 days. Associations should document scheduling and commencement as required and coordinate directly with their design professional and local enforcement agency.
If proof that repairs are scheduled or commenced is not submitted within the required timeframe, the local enforcement agency must review the circumstances and determine whether the building is unsafe for human occupancy. Milestone Inspection vs. SIRS
A Milestone Inspection and a Structural Integrity Reserve Study (SIRS) are separate legal requirements. The milestone inspection is a structural inspection conducted by a Florida-licensed architect or engineer. A SIRS addresses reserve funding for specified building components. Florida law permits them to be performed simultaneously in certain circumstances, but one is not a substitute for the other and a structural finding should not be reduced to a reserve-budget line item.
What Documents Should the Association Give the Contractor?
- The complete Milestone Inspection report and Phase 2 report, including appendices and photographs.
- Signed and sealed repair drawings, specifications, addenda and testing requirements, if issued.
- Prior structural, concrete, balcony, garage and building-envelope reports relevant to the scope.
- Available waterproofing, sealant and coating records, including known prior repair locations.
- Building access rules, balcony or unit-entry constraints, parking plans, work-hour limits and logistics information.
- Correspondence, notices, deadlines or permit information from the local enforcement agency.
What Good Closeout Looks Like
A useful closeout package shows what happened at each repair location. It should organize final quantities, before/during/after photographs, approved submittals, RFIs and written responses, EOR field directions, specified testing results, material records, change documentation and warranties where applicable. The final record should reconcile the original scope with the completed work rather than leave those facts scattered across emails and pay applications.
DBPR guidance states that after required repairs have been made, a professional reinspects the building and provides an amended report stating that the required repairs are complete and the building is acceptable for continued occupancy. That professional reinspection and amended report remain the work of the legally qualified professional, not the restoration contractor.

Frequently asked questions
Does a Phase 2 Milestone Inspection mean the building is unsafe?
Not automatically. Phase 2 is required when Phase 1 identifies substantial structural deterioration and is used to investigate structural distress and recommend an assessment or repair program. The licensed architect or engineer reports unsafe or dangerous conditions if observed, and the local authority determines required enforcement actions.
Does every Milestone Inspection require Phase 2?
No. If the licensed architect or engineer finds no signs of substantial structural deterioration during Phase 1, Phase 2 is not required. The Phase 1 report may still recommend remedial or preventive work for other damaged items.
How quickly must Phase 2 structural repairs begin?
For substantial structural deterioration identified in a Phase 2 report, repairs must be commenced within the statutory 365-day period, unless the local enforcement agency imposes an earlier schedule. This is a commencement rule, not a universal 365-day completion deadline. The association should follow the specific timeframe and direction established by its design professional and local authority.
Who designs and specifies the repairs?
The Florida-licensed design professional or Engineer of Record evaluates the conditions, designs and specifies the repairs, and provides engineering direction as required. CONCRE does not substitute for that professional or make structural-capacity determinations.
What is the contractor’s role after the engineering report?
The restoration contractor plans access and protection, maps and measures repair locations, performs the specified work, reports differing conditions, coordinates EOR review points, manages QA/QC and compiles the field and closeout documentation.
Is a Milestone Inspection the same as a SIRS?
No. A Milestone Inspection is a structural inspection by a Florida-licensed architect or engineer. A Structural Integrity Reserve Study addresses reserve funding for specified components. They are separate requirements, although Florida law permits them to be performed simultaneously in certain circumstances.
